Finland is known for innovative high-technology and in the opening event of The ISU World Figure Skating Championships 2017 in Helsinki, technology combines with athletic beauty to create something very unique. Elina Loueranta, designer at Biancaneve, is working with the light-technology company Neonelektro to create an innovative costume that depicts the theme of the opening event, light.
Special led lights and Swarovski crystals are combined with the base fabric to form the unique costume. This creates a perfect mirage of a star shooting through the dark. The modern costume which is worth thousands of euros has taken influence from Lady Gaga’s Super Bowl outfit. It will be seen on the talented acrobat Heidi Latva.
The designer of the costume is a former figure skater herself, for whom the sport is still close to her heart.
-It is incredible to be a part of this project! Both Figure skating and my home country Finland are close to my heart, and the ISU World Figure Skating Championships 2017 in Helsinki combines them. I have been designing costumes for twenty years. As a child I fantasized about making costumes for figure skaters in the future so for me this really is a dream come true.
